Me neither! If it isn't real chocolate it just isn't right!
All I did was take a hi protein vanilla ensure (you could use skim milk or another protein drink) added a scoop of protein powder, 1 tablespoon of pumpkin puree and some pumpkin spice and blended it up and poured it over ice. Give it a whirl | |
